First and foremost, a thorough inspection is a must. Don't be shy about getting up close and personal with the **garage**. Check for any signs of damage, such as rot, rust, cracks, or warping. Pay special attention to the roof, walls, and foundation. These are the areas that are most exposed to the elements and can be prone to deterioration. Bring a flashlight and look for any areas where light shines through, which could indicate holes or weaknesses. If you're not comfortable doing the inspection yourself, consider hiring a professional. They can spot potential problems that you might miss.

Next up, we have the Hunter, the agile, pouncing predator of the **_Left 4 Dead_** universe. The Hunter's voice lines are another crucial part of the game's audio design, adding a layer of tension and suspense to every encounter. The Hunter is known for its distinctive high-pitched growl, which morphs into a scream as it pounces on its prey. In essence, the Hunter's vocalizations are all about stealth and aggression. When it's lurking in the shadows, waiting to ambush its victims, it emits a low growl, a warning that something dangerous is nearby. This low growl is designed to create a sense of unease and dread. The Hunter wants you to be scared, so he can have fun. As the Hunter prepares to attack, its growl intensifies, rising in pitch until the moment it leaps forward, turning into a bloodcurdling scream. This is the moment you know you are about to get pounced. The scream is not just a sound effect; it's a call to action for the Hunter and a warning to the survivors. It is an indication that it’s ready to strike. The hunter's voice lines also include variations in the screams. There's a high-pitched shriek when it attacks, a sound that gets stuck in your head and keeps you on edge. The hunter's sounds are a crucial part of the game. That scream is the cue for the survivors to react and try to save their teammate, adding to the game's frantic, chaotic gameplay. The developers included the sounds so that players would be able to know that they are being hunted, and to know when they are about to be attacked. This makes the gameplay more fun, and thrilling.

Think about science fiction, for instance. Shows like *Star Trek* have been credited with inspiring technological advancements like cell phones and tablets. While the show didn't *cause* these inventions, it certainly played a role in *envisioning* them and making them seem less like outlandish fantasies and more like attainable goals. Similarly, shows like *The Handmaid's Tale*, while dystopian and unsettling, reflect real-world concerns about societal control, gender inequality, and the erosion of individual rights. They hold a mirror up to our fears, amplifying them and prompting us to consider the potential consequences of the paths we're on.
